Inside Secure has been chosen by a partnership of French public bodies to supply an NFC-based system for home care services in France.

Homecare visitors will be equipped with NFC-based smartphones with which they can make quick updates of administrative, financial or management data related to each visit they make. The service is particularly geared to home visits for the elderly who are equpped with NFC ID card which is scanned by carers.

The resulting data is then uploaded to a central database via the 3G network. The aim is to save time and reduce errors by collecting data in this way.

The vendor is supplying NFC technology to an e-health project called Confiance whose brief is to improve the management of services for dependent people who live at home, particularly the elderly. 

However, the timing and extent of the system's deployment is unclear.

The project is a partnership between Docapost, a digital transactions company owned by La Poste, France’s postal service, and Abrapa, a social welfare association. The partnership is financed by the French government.
